Can Anthony Lynn bring smashmouth football back to Detroit?

Lost in the recent trade drama surrounding quarterback Matthew Stafford was the report that the Detroit Lions have found their new offensive coordinator. According to ESPN’s Dan Graziano, the Lions intend to hire Anthony Lynn to fill the position.

The former head coach for the Los Angeles Chargers is set to replace Darrell Bevell as the Lions’ offensive coordinator. Bevell is reportedly set to join the Jacksonville Jaguars under their new head coach, Urban Meyer.

The 52-year old Lynn got his start in the NFL as a running back for six seasons playing for the New York Giants, San Francisco 49ers, and the Denver Broncos.
